Ingredients
Scale
1 pound boneless chicken thighs
1 tablespoon ginger, minced
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 tablespoon garam masala
1 teaspoon turmeric
1 teaspoon cumin
1 can (14 ounces) diced tomatoes
1 cup heavy cream
2 tablespoons butter
Salt to taste
Fresh cilantro for garnish
Instructions
In a large skillet, melt the butter over medium heat.
Add the minced ginger and garlic, sautéing until fragrant.
Add the chicken thighs, cooking until browned.
Stir in the spices and toss to coat the chicken.
Add the diced tomatoes and bring to a simmer.
Stir in the heavy cream, cooking until the chicken is cooked through.
Adjust salt to taste and garnish with fresh cilantro before serving.
Notes
This dish pairs beautifully with rice or naan bread.
For a vegetarian option, substitute chicken with tofu or chickpeas.
